Been hearing and seeing so many blogs talking about Riders' Cafe.
Since I kept talking about it, my bf decided to bring me there
Reserved a seating at around 11.30am - it's good to book for reservations, but it wasn't as crowded as I thought.
Just to let you know, there's no air con.
And, occasionally you'll get to enjoy the smell of dungs. (I smelled it the moment I got off the car, and while I was eating, there was a time when the smell was pretty strong *puke*)

I highly recommend this smoothie - felt like I was drinking some health potion which immediately got me going "OOOH"
according to the menu, it consists of orange juice, banana, berries, yoghurt and honey.
